Transaction 5fb7436d03d2c61cf3707571a93b0f92f5fc6132bb27d0cb58c3832051654d0d
1 Input
1 Output
-
5fb7436d03d2c61cf3707571a93b0f92f5fc6132bb27d0cb58c3832051654d0d:0
- value
- 9318540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a8810ffefc90e13baf7f62b4c26e3b300fe41de OP_EQUAL
- address
- 347JVbE89AaUAiht4c1eLAZaM9kcReNRH8